Assigning Roles and Profiles to Authorization
Object S_TREX_ADM 
You can launch the TREX admin tool in the SAP system using transaction TREXADMIN, which is assigned to the authorization object S_TREX_ADM. You can control the authorizations for the TREX admin tool in the SAP system by assigning certain roles and profiles to the authorization object S_TREX_ADM.
The SAP authorization concept protects transactions and programs in SAP systems from unauthorized access. On the basis of the authorization concept the administrator gives users authorizations that define which actions those users can carry out in SAP systems after logging onto those systems and carrying out authentication. When a user starts a program or calls up a transaction, the system carries out authorization checks and makes sure that the user has the correct authorizations. The SAP system can then determine which users should be able to carry out which functions and what users should be able to do with data (insert, create, execute, display, change, delete, and so on). It can also determine the organizational limits within which users can carry out these actions. Activity groups, profiles, collective profiles, authorization objects, control fields, and transactions are important parts of this concept.

You are using Search and Classification (TREX) in the SAP system.
1.
Assign the
authorization object S_TREX_ADM to the roles and profiles to which you want to give
authorization for the TREX admin tool in the SAP system. To do this you can
create a new role or profile or you can use existing ones. You carry out these
activities in transaction PFCG (role maintenance).

2. Set the value for the authorization object in the field ACTVT to 16 (execute).
This value gives the role or profile in question permission to call up and execute the transaction TREXADMIN.
The transaction TREXADMIN, and therefore the TREX admin tool in the SAP system, can only be called up by users who have authorization due to being assigned to a relevant role or profile.
